DescriptionThis image depicts an aerial of the Fourth Street Plaza at Fourth Street and Central Avenue in Albuquerque, New Mexico. The floor of the plaza is made of red bricks and cement. Numerous people can be seen walking both towards and away from the point of view of the camera. A row of picnic tables and benches can be seen near the left side of the frame. To the left of these tables is a row of small, newly planted trees. A small grassy area can be seen in the midground of the image. The brick pathway can be seen continuing to the parking lot to the right of the grass. In the background, on the right, a parking lot with various types of vehicles can be seen.
